<p>These are some of the most popular formulas used in geometry to calculate the circumference, area, volume, and surface areas of various shapes such as squares, rectangles, triangles, parallelograms, circles, trapezoids, and so on.</p>


<div class="wp-block-image">
<figure class="aligncenter size-full"><img fetchpriority="high" decoding="async" width="370" height="220" src="https://www.mathansr.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/09/Geometry-Formulas.jpg" alt="Geometry Formulas" class="wp-image-901" title="List of Geometry Formulas 1" srcset="https://www.mathansr.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/09/Geometry-Formulas.jpg 370w, https://www.mathansr.com/wp-content/uploads/2022/09/Geometry-Formulas-300x178.jpg 300w" sizes="(max-width: 370px) 100vw, 370px" /></figure></div>


<h2 class="wp-block-heading"><strong>Geometry Formulas List</strong></h2>



<p>The following is a collection of different formulae related to geometry that you can use according to the shape of the geometric object.</p>



<p>The perimeter of a Square = 4(Side)<br>Perimeter of a Rectangle = 2(Length + Breadth)<br>Area of a Square = Side<sup>2</sup><br>Area of a Rectangle = Length × Breadth<br>Area of a Triangle = ½ × base × height<br>Area of a Trapezoid = ½ × (base<sub>1</sub> + base<sub>2</sub>) × height</p>



<p><strong>Basic geometry formulas where the mathematical constant π is used are</strong>,</p>



<p>Area of a Circle = A = π×r<sup>2</sup><br>Circumference of a Circle = 2πr<br>The curved surface area of a Cylinder = 2πrh<br>Total surface area of a Cylinder = 2πr(r + h)<br>Volume of a Cylinder = V = πr<sup>2</sup>h<br>The curved surface area of a cone = πrl<br>Total surface area of a cone = πr(r+l) = πr[r+√(h<sup>2</sup>+r<sup>2</sup>)]<br>Volume of a Cone = V = ⅓×πr2h<br>Surface Area of a Sphere = S = 4πr<sup>2</sup><br>Volume of a Sphere = V = 4/3×πr<sup>3</sup></p>



<p>where,</p>



<p>r = Radius;<br>h = Height. and,<br>l = Slant height</p>

<h2 class="wp-block-heading"><strong>List of Algebra Formulas Class 9</strong></h2>



<p>This list of algebra formulae for class 9 can be used to solve various algebraic equations.</p>



<p>a<sup>2</sup> &#8211; b<sup>2</sup> = (a &#8211; b)(a + b)</p>



<p>(a + b)<sup>2</sup> = a<sup>2</sup> + 2ab + b<sup>2</sup></p>



<p>a<sup>2</sup> + b<sup>2</sup> = (a + b)<sup>2</sup> &#8211; 2ab.</p>



<p>(a &#8211; b)<sup>2</sup> = a<sup>2</sup> &#8211; 2ab + b<sup>2</sup></p>



<p>(a + b)<sup>3</sup> = a<sup>3</sup> + b<sup>3</sup> + 3ab(a + b)</p>



<p>(a &#8211; b)<sup>3</sup> = a<sup>3</sup> &#8211; b<sup>3</sup> &#8211; 3ab(a &#8211; b)</p>



<p>a<sup>3</sup> &#8211; b<sup>3</sup> = (a &#8211; b)(a<sup>2</sup> + ab + b<sup>2</sup>)</p>



<p>a<sup>3</sup> + b<sup>3</sup> = (a + b)(a<sup>2</sup> &#8211; ab + b<sup>2</sup>)</p>



<p>x(a + b) = xa + xb </p>



<p>x(a &#8211; b) = xa &#8211; xb</p>



<p>(x &#8211; a)(x &#8211; b) = x<sup>2</sup> &#8211; (a + b)x + ab</p>



<p>(x &#8211; a)(x + b) = x<sup>2</sup> + (b &#8211; a)x &#8211; ab</p>



<p>(x + a)(x &#8211; b)= x<sup>2</sup> + (a &#8211; b)x &#8211; ab</p>



<p>(x + a)(x + b)= x<sup>2</sup> + (a + b)x + ab</p>



<p>(x + y + z)<sup>2</sup> = x<sup>2</sup> + y<sup>2</sup> + z<sup>2</sup> + 2xy + 2yz + 2zx</p>



<p>(x &#8211; y &#8211; z)<sup>2</sup> = x<sup>2</sup> + y<sup>2</sup> + z<sup>2</sup> &#8211; 2xy + 2yz &#8211; 2zx</p>

<h2 class="wp-block-heading"><strong>What is the formula for the perfect square?</strong></h2>



<p>When we need to calculate the square of any binomial, we use the perfect square formula. It factors terms or calculates the square of the sum or difference of two terms. The perfect square equation is:</p>



<p class="has-text-align-center has-contrast-color has-text-color has-x-large-font-size">&nbsp;(a ± b)<sup>2</sup>&nbsp;= (a<sup>2&nbsp;</sup>± 2ab&nbsp;+ b<sup>2</sup>)</p>
